We booked this hotel off the back of the photos and the price before reading reviews on the hotel. This trip was our dream honeymoon to Rome and having read reviews after we had booked, we were expecting the Honeymoon from hell.

Reasons for booking:- didnt want to be in the centre of Rome with all the hustle, bustle and noise but wanted good transport links into city centre. Location of hotel could not be better as Metro is just across the road and only 15/20 mins to city centre.

Upon arrival (11.30 a.m) we were told that we could not check in until 2 p.m.. Basil lookalike and his sidekick Manuel could not of been less helpful in directing us to the supermarket and Metro but as we had a few hours to kill we braved it ourselves. The supermarket is just up the road and we used this regularly to purchase water, wine and nibbles. As a rule you will pay anything from 1.50 - 2.50 euros for a cold bottle of small water from stands and a full 1.5 litre bottle from supermarket was 0.35 euros. Just pray your fridge works in the hotel room. Ours didnt and tried the leaving the door open trick but that had no impact. Couldnt be bothered to complain having read other reviews and the lack of urgency to problems from Manuel & Basil.

On the first night we didnt feel like going into the city centre as been up since 2 in the morning. We decided to eat in the resturant. DONT do it !!! we waited a good hour to finally get our meal which was very nice. However, we had a main course each, 2 side dishes and water and it came to 49 euros !!! The wine is ever so overpriced, 16 euros for half bottle!!! you can get a half decent bottle of Frascati from the Supermarket for 3.50 euros.. You do the maths.. The other thing is that they give preference to local Italians over guests and this is blatantly obvious to all!!!

Breakfast is only cold meats, bread, cereal, fruit, yoghurt and very continetal.. We had no problem with this as if u want a full english, go to Spain. Unlimited amounts so you can get a good fill before you then go out and treak the city.

The hotel was very clean but it seems as though the resturant and bar were run as a seperate business. We insisted upon a double room at the back of the hotel having read reviews of how noisy it is at the front. This was just perfect as we ended up with a suite room which was very large and comfortable. If you can, request the same as the normal double rooms are very small apparently. The maids did a great job every day and left the rooms spotless.

Even though we renamed the hotel "Fawlty American Palace" we had a pleasant time there and for the cost would recommend. Its not a four star hotel and at best a good 3. Doubt we would stay again but location good for transport and a good base to start from.. not much else around the hotel to do but if like us you are only using it as somewhere to sleep, get refreshed and have breakfast then its just fine..

The positives: the room was clean, the furniture new, the reception staff efficient.
The negatives: the (single) room was tiny. The temperature gauge on the (old) radiator was missing, the table map did not work, the door to the bathroom did not close, the windows were single glazed and rattled, the room door afforded no sound insulation and conversations at the end of the corridor sounded as if they were in the room, the gym was small and stuffed with machines (no treadmill though, nor TV).
The worst: the night I ate there, there was no menu, no prices, choice from waiter for the second course was "steak, chicken or pork", we were offered no bread, no water, no salt / pepper...; the breakfast the next morning was frankly dreadful and seemed to be as cheap as they could possibly get away with - bad orange juice out of a machine (ie not fresh orange), horrible coffee out of a machine; the cheese was plasticky; there were no teaspoons (soup spoons had to be used to eat yoghourt and stir sugar into coffee); you had to find your own table, ask for plates, join long line for the coffee machine.

The hotel was busy and I was left wondering who would choose to stay there (I was working nearby) : it looked liked German coach trippers. There appears to be a dearth of good hotels nearby. Stay here if you absolutely have to, but eat elsewhere and as someone else said, don't expect a 4 star hotel.

Well the hotel was not a typical four star hotel but it was worth the money we paid for our room. The room was very small but clean. We also had a tv and a hairdryer in our room. The staff were very friendly and helpful and even ordered us a taxi without charging an extra fee for it. They also sopke English very well. The food was not bad and for breakfast there was a cold buffet with croissants, roles, fruits and cereals. However it was very crowded and we had to just had to sit at a table which still had dirty dishes on it. For dinner they ask you wether you want water and they will charge you for it. Its not very expensive though and cheaper then water in Austria.
The metro is also very close and within 20 minutes you are at Trevoli Station.
There was also very good gelateria 5 minutes away. By the taxi stands you turn left and on the right side. We went there twice and it was always full of locals.
There are no other Restaurants close so either you eat in the Restaurant there, eat in town or go to a Pizzeria which there are enough of close to the Restaurant.
I think that the hotel was worth what we paid for it and the location is also not bad because you are located a bit out of town.
